Summary: | This paper presents the implementation in Phyton of an algorithm for recommending educational resources based on the user’s needs, where these resources will be obtained through the use of the YouTube API that suggests videos of educational materials focused on the student’s level of knowledge to customize the recommendations, taking into consideration data obtained from a knowledge survey and the academic grades obtained from different resources made from the Moodle learning platform. The emphasis is on building an RS with the capacity to assist in educational settings. The RSs applied in education allow students to find materials that fit their needs and preferences, and the recommended materials are adapted to the pedagogical objectives of the teachers. It should be noted that the implementation of the project was carried out in a controlled environment, with the interaction of a group of students of a particular subject and semester. |
